The Most Common Problems in Pre-1960s Homes
Worn or Missing Rollers and Hinges
On older garage doors, the rollers and hinges take the most cumulative abuse. Over time, these components become rusted or damaged and stop doing their job cleanly. The result is the loud, grinding noise that many homeowners in older Glenmont properties have simply gotten used to as background noise. It shouldn't be background noise. Worn rollers and hinges create metal-on-metal friction that accelerates wear across the entire system. tracks, cables, and springs all end up working harder to compensate.
Replacing rollers and hinges is one of the more affordable repairs in the garage door world, and it makes a noticeable difference immediately. If your door wakes up the whole house every time it opens, start here.
Rust and Corrosion on Hardware
Garage doors in this part of Ohio have been exposed to road salt, snow, humidity, and freeze-thaw moisture for generations. Rust is a common problem, especially on the operational parts. springs, rollers, and tracks. Surface rust on panels is mostly cosmetic, but rust on springs and cables is a structural concern. Corroded springs are weaker springs, and weaker springs fail without warning.
If you see reddish-brown discoloration on the springs or cables in your garage, don't wait. Check for dry or rusty spots on the operational components and address them before they compromise the system entirely. Outdated Opener Technology
Many homes in Glenmont that were originally built without attached garages had openers retrofitted years or even decades after construction. Those openers. especially anything installed before the mid-2000s. lack the safety features, rolling code technology, and cold-weather circuit reliability that modern units have. Older openers with aging circuits struggle in Ohio winters, and they often lack the safety reversal mechanisms required by current safety standards.

Panel Warping and Structural Wear
Older garage door panels. particularly wood ones. are vulnerable to the cycle of moisture, freeze, and heat that defines Holmes County seasons. Wood absorbs water, swells, contracts, and over years of that cycle it warps. Warped panels don't just look bad; they create gaps that compromise insulation and security, and they put uneven stress on the tracks and springs that have to move them.
Steel panels on older doors can also dent and corrode. If you notice any visible dents, cracks, or warping on your garage door panels, it's worth having them assessed. not just for appearance, but because damaged panels affect the structural integrity of the whole door.
What to Prioritize First
If you're looking at an older door and not sure where to start, here's a practical order of operations:
1. Listen and watch the door in motion. Grinding, squealing, jerky movement, or a door that sits crooked when closed are all diagnostic signals you can gather just by observing a few cycles. 2. Check the hardware visually. Look at springs, cables, hinges, and rollers for visible rust, fraying, or damage. You don't need to touch anything. just look. 3. Test the balance. Disconnect the opener, lift the door manually to the halfway point, and let go. If it moves on its own in either direction, the springs need attention from a professional. 4. Check the weatherstripping. On a cold morning, see if you can feel cold air seeping under or around the door. Failed seals on older homes are very common and inexpensive to fix.

Repair or Replace? An Honest Assessment
This is the question most homeowners with older doors eventually face, and there's no universal answer. A door that's structurally sound but has worn hardware often makes more sense to repair. new rollers, hinges, springs, and an opener can add years of reliable life. A door with warped or rotted panels, a compromised frame, or hardware that's failed multiple times in a short period is a better candidate for full replacement.

Frequently Asked Questions
Q: My garage door is noisy but still works fine. Do I really need to fix it? A: Noise is usually a symptom, not just an annoyance. Worn rollers and loose hardware create friction that accelerates wear on other components. including springs and cables. Fixing the noise early is almost always cheaper than waiting for the downstream damage it causes.
Q: How do I know if my old garage door opener is still safe to use? A: Openers made before 1993 may not have the auto-reverse safety feature required by current safety standards, which causes the door to reverse if it contacts an obstruction. If your opener is old and you're unsure, a technician can test it in about five minutes. It's worth knowing.
Q: Can I just replace the springs and keep my old door? A: In most cases, yes. as long as the panels are structurally sound and the tracks aren't severely warped. Spring replacement on an otherwise functional older door is a cost-effective repair. The key is making sure the new springs are correctly sized for the door's weight, which is why this is a job for a professional rather than a DIY project.
